Inoculation – Juice or Must Plus Yeast
Inoculation is a key process in winemaking that involves the addition of selected strains of yeast or bacteria to a wine must to control the fermentation process and produce desirable flavors and aromas in the resulting wine. Isinglass – Fish Bladder in My Wine? Please Clarify?
Isinglass is a protein derived from the swim bladder of fish, which is commonly used as a fining agent in winemaking.
